About Plastech Corporation

Acquired by Dennis Frandsen in 1963, Plastech is now a diversified custom manufacturer of high-quality, injection-molded components and fully assembled products. The company is still actively managed by Frandsen and his grandsons, Luca Bonvicini, Nick Frandsen, and Alex Knox. Financial stability, bolstered by 60 years of continuity, has enabled Plastech to steadily expand its injection-molding capabilities and plastics-processing technologies. Operating a wide array of press sizes (up to 1,500 tons), Plastech is an ISO 9001:2008 certified and complete supplier of injection molded, assembled, and packaged products for drop shipment to customers throughout North America by focusing on a single objective—Perfect Parts, On Time, Every Time.
